β¦ Synopsis
The distributed systems architect assembles pieces of hardware that are at least as large as a computer or a network router, and assigns pieces of software that are self-contained - such as Java applets - to those hardware components. As system complexity, size and diversity grow, the probability of inconsistency, unreliability, non-responsiveness and insecurity, increases. It is absolutely necessary for distributed systems architects to understand the management of such complex systems. Distributed Systems for System Architects addresses these issues.
